Windows and doors are necessary elements of any building, supplying functionality and visual appeals while adding to energy efficiency and security. Gradually, wear and tear can result in a variety of problems, making prompt repairs crucial for maintaining the stability of these fixtures. Typical Problems with Windows and Doors
Windows and doors can experience a series of concerns with time. Understanding these common issues can assist house owners take prompt action, boosting both the durability and effectiveness of their components.
Typical Issues EncounteredDrafts: Poor insulation can permit cold air in and warm air out, causing increased energy bills.Difficulty in Operation: Windows and doors may become stuck or hard to open due to swelling from humidity or other factors.Broken Seals: Double-glazed windows can establish broken seals that compromise insulation.Squeaky Hinges: [Doors repairs near me](https://www.mauriciostakley.top/maintenance/the-comprehensive-guide-to-door-repairs-keeping-your-home-secure-and-functional/) typically suffer from squeaks due to worn-out hinges or lack of lubrication.Split Glass: External factors such as hail or flying particles can lead to cracked or broken glass panes.Decomposing Frames: Wooden frames can rot due to prolonged exposure to moisture.Misalignment: Doors may become misaligned, triggering spaces that allow insects or moisture to get in.Condensation: Moisture in between glass panes suggests an unsuccessful seal, impacting insulation and clearness.Issue TypeSignsPossible CausesDraftsFeel cold air around windows/doorsPoor insulation or worn weather condition removingDifficulty in OperationSticking or hard to openSwelling from humidity or dirt buildupBroken SealsCondensation between glass panesFailures in adhesive or sealantSqueaky HingesNoise when opening/closing doorsWorn-out hinges or lack of lubricationBroken GlassNoticeable cracks or shatteringHail or impact damageDecaying FramesFlaking paint, soft woodLong exposure to wetnessMisalignmentGaps or irregular closingSettling of your homeCondensationMoisture trapped in between panesFailed sealsImportance of Timely Repairs

Understanding the costs connected with doors and window repairs can assist property owners budget plan effectively. The following table lays out common repair expenses:
Repair TypeEstimated Cost RangeWeatherstripping₤ 5 - ₤ 20 per windowLubrication of Hinges₤ 10 - ₤ 30Glass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 500 per paneFrame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 1000 per windowExpert Repair Service₤ 75 - ₤ 150 per hour
Note: Costs can differ based upon location, the intricacy of the repair, and the products used.

How frequently should I perform maintenance on my windows and doors?
At minimum, examine your windows and doors twice a year, ideally in the spring and fall. Regular maintenance can prevent more substantial concerns.
